Finding the Street-Level Images You Need in Mapillary FOSS4G Hiroshima 2026 LT Hironori Banno (bannyaaa)

2.

What is Mapillary? An open data platform for crowdsourced street-level images Mapillary Platform Upload Download Open data (CC BY-SA)

3.

©︎ ©︎ ©︎ ©︎ ©︎ ©︎ Mapillary Has Diverse Images Different subjects and capture conditions ChenJJ (CC BY-SA) musashino5 (CC BY-SA) Ca73 (CC BY-SA) yasunari (CC BY-SA) snhoybekcxnb (CC BY-SA) mitz (CC BY-SA) We need to select images that fit our purpose

4.

Demo Scenario Find images from central Hiroshima like the example below: Sampling area Target image example Bright Pedestrian / driver viewpoint Non-panoramic Sharp @lvl5 (CC BY-SA) Area data: MLIT National Land Numerical Information (Administrative Areas) modified (CC BY 4.0) Map data: @OpenStreetMap contributors

5.

Three-Step Filtering Pipeline Metadata Low Non-AI Image Analysis AI-based Image Analysis Brightness / Blur Semantic Segmentation Computational cost Start with lower-cost steps High

6.

©︎ 1. Filtering with Metadata Every Mapillary image has metadata Image Metadata image id: 2157221781753991 captured at: Feb 7, 2026, 2:11 PM is panoramic: False geometry: Point (132.47, 34.40) compass angle: 5.47 maheshika (CC BY-SA) quality score: 0.69 creator id: 102993915277414 … …

7.

©︎ ©︎ ©︎ 1. Filtering with Metadata Selected Not selected Daytime Nighttime created at: @drivephotograph (CC BY-SA) alt9800 (CC BY-SA) Panoramic Non-panoramic is panoramic: okadatsuneo (CC BY-SA) potaro67v (CC BY-SA) Filtering before download reduces later processing

8.

©︎ ©︎ ©︎ ©︎ 2. Filtering with Brightness and Blur Selected Bright Not selected Slightly dark Brightness: okadatsuneo (CC BY-SA) drivephotograph (CC BY-SA) Blurred Sharp Blur: hiroshi (CC BY-SA) yasunari (CC BY-SA) ※Brightness: Mean RGB, Blur: Laplacian variance, Using OpenCV Simple and fast checks for basic image quality

9.

©︎ 3. Filtering with Semantic Segmentation Input lvl5 (CC BY-SA) Output Road: 32%, Building: 30%, Vegetation: 15%, … ※Using Mask2Former (facebook/mask2former-swin-tiny-cityscapes-semantic)

10.

©︎ ©︎ ©︎ ©︎ 3. Filtering with Semantic Segmentation Road + Sidewalk ≥ 10% Selected Not selected jopparn, modified (CC BY-SA) jopparn (CC BY-SA) lvl5, modified (CC BY-SA) okadatsuneo (CC BY-SA) Helps select pedestrian / driver viewpoint

11.

©︎ ©︎ ©︎ Filtering Results Metadata Non-AI Image Analysis AI-based Image Analysis Selected … okadatsuneo (CC BY-SA) @drivephotograph (CC BY-SA) lvl5 (CC BY-SA) jopparn (CC BY-SA) Build a filtering pipeline for your purpose

12.

Finding the Street-Level Images You Need ✓The diversity of images is a key feature of Mapillary ✓Every image is valuable to someone Filtering helps you find images that fit your purpose!
